S A N J 0 A Q I I I Irl Environmental Health Department <br /> CCUN r <br /> Large Quantity Hazardous Waste Generator Inspection Report <br /> Facility Name: Facility Address: Date: <br /> PANELLA TRUCKING LLC 5000 E FREMONT ST, STOCKTON October 29, 2019 <br /> SUMMARY OF VIOLATIONS <br /> (CLASS I,CLASS II,or MINOR-Notice to Comply) <br /> Item# Remarks <br /> 115 CCR 66262.42(a)(b)(d)Failed to comply with uniform hazardous waste manifest exception requirements. <br /> OBSERVATION: The facility did not have exception reports on site for Uniform Hazardous Waste Manifests <br /> (UHWM): <br /> -011209218FLE (2/14/2018) <br /> -012800765FLE (3/10/2019) <br /> -012794927FLE (6/23/2019) <br /> REGULATION: (a)A generator who does not receive a copy of the manifest with the handwritten signature of the <br /> owner or operator of the designated facility within 35 days of the date the waste was accepted by the initial <br /> transporter shall contact the transporter and/or the owner or operator of the designated facility to determine the <br /> status of the hazardous waste. <br /> (b)A generator shall submit an Exception Report to the Department if the generator has not received a copy of the <br /> manifest with the handwritten signature of the owner or operator of the designated facility within 45 days of the date <br /> the waste was accepted by the initial transporter.The Exception Report shall include: <br /> (1)a legible copy of the manifest for which the generator does not have confirmation of delivery; <br /> (2)a cover letter signed by the generator or the generator's authorized representative explaining the efforts taken to <br /> locate the hazardous waste and the results of those efforts. <br /> (d)Generators shall submit the exception report to the department at: DTSC Report Repository, Generator <br /> Information Services Section, P.O. Box 806, Sacramento, CA 95812-0806 <br /> CORRECTIVE ACTION: Locate a copy of the destination facility signed manifests and send a copy to the San <br /> Joaquin County Environmental Health Department(EHD). If the destination facility signed manifests cannot be <br /> found then prepare an exception report for each missing manifest as required by Title 22 California Code of <br /> Regulations section 66262.42. The exception report shall include a legible copy of the manifest for which the <br /> generator does not have confirmation of delivery and a cover letter signed by the generator or the generator's <br /> authorized representative explaining the efforts taken to locate the hazardous waste and the results of those efforts. <br /> DTSC address is DTSC Report Repository, Generator Information Services Section, PO Box 806, Sacramento, CA <br /> 95812-0806. Send a copy of the exception report to DTSC and the EHD. <br /> This is a minor violation. <br /> 118 HSC 25160.2(b)(3) Failed to keep copies of consolidated manifesting receipts for three years. <br /> OBSERVATION: Copies of consolidated manifest receipts from 2/6/2019, 3/21/2019 and 4/22/2019 for hazardous <br /> wastes including used oil were not found on site during the inspection <br /> REGULATION GUIDANCE: The generator shall retain each consolidated manifest receipt for at least three years. <br /> This period of retention is extended automatically during the course of any unresolved enforcement action regarding <br /> the regulated activity or as requested by the department or a certified unified program agency. <br /> CORRECTIVE ACTION: Immediately locate a copy of all consolidated manifest receipts from 2/2019 to 4/2019 and <br /> maintain them on site.
